应用加高单体液压支柱回采实践

摘    要:对于2.4~3.8m厚小块段支护,选择一次采全厚的单体支护系统比较适合。依据现有单体规格,提出了增加单体高度的改进措施。该回采工艺为2.4~3.8m厚小块段煤层回采创建了一个成功的范例。

关 键 词:中厚煤层  单体液压支柱  回采工艺  工作阻力

Abstract:The supporting system selection is analyzed in mining small piece of 2.4 - 3.8 m middle and high seam. Using single hydraulic supporting system mined by one time is reasonable. According to the size of sigle hydraulic postes, The single hydraulic post improvement with height added is pointed out. A good demonstration has been set up in mining small piece of 2.4 - 3.8 middle and high seam by practice.
